Transaction bbafcc5ea5956029c13779e7ede2d61b8c57792510d57e4a8094bb903296921a
1 Input
1 Output
-
bbafcc5ea5956029c13779e7ede2d61b8c57792510d57e4a8094bb903296921a:0
- value
- 5006610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 286e5763ec99672d332ed07f04b2f0108475e97c OP_EQUAL
- address
- 35No8sPnGu6oLD8biixt6k6ajaZK8uM7Pc